在SQL 2012中执行SQLAgent作业时出错,该作业启动了2008年构建的ssis包

时间:2015-08-19 09:55:33

标签: ssis sql-server-2008-r2 sql-server-2012 sql-agent-job

我在2008 R2中构建了一个SSIS包。它工作得很好所以现在我想将它安装在客户的服务器上。虽然他们已经安装了SQL Server 2012。 转换包后,我已经成功地在解决方案中执行了它。 虽然如果我尝试运行用于执行包的SQL Server代理作业,它会出现以下错误:

  

要在SQL Server数据工具之外运行SSIS包,您必须这样做   安装读取Integration Services或更高版本的Ini。

(读取Ini是包应该执行的第一个任务。)

我已经检查过并安装了Integration Services 11.0。此外,SQL Server代理用户已被授予Integration Services的权限。

该软件包已在Integration Services 10.0下构建。

提前致谢。

1 个答案:

答案 0 :(得分:0)

整合服务有点敏感 你可以执行,因为当你抓住包装时,它会在你的机器上运行。

我建议在SSIS 2012上重新创建这个包。